Verb Conjugation - Tai-Form (Desire)

Conjugating 消える (kieru) in Tai-Form (Desire)

In Japanese, the verb 消える (meaning "to to go out / disappear / fade (intransitive)", JLPT N3) conjugates in the Tai-Form (Desire) form as 消えたい (kietai). Verb group: Group 2.

Context Example

消えたい。
Kietai.
I want to go out.
